Transaction 84988330044c99cc920f80bb95e052b8a8e057dea4ef33a61cfced0f8dd452ac
1 Input
1 Output
-
84988330044c99cc920f80bb95e052b8a8e057dea4ef33a61cfced0f8dd452ac:0
- value
- 380
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fa077854fc68c8fcbb0e9e26aad94ce533f7c6b9572529829a1518899105ede5
- address
- bc1plgrhs48udry0ewcwncn24k2vu5el034e2ujjnq56z5vgnyg9ahjsgf0dcc